Changed defaults, on-call folks, so read this one. The loyalty-points ledger now batches accrual writes every 500ms instead of per-transaction, which cuts write load roughly 60% but means balances can lag by up to a second. Alerts tuned accordingly — don't panic at small transient mismatches between the ledger and the rewards cache; they self-heal. Reversals still apply synchronously. If a batch flush fails three times, the service halts accruals and pages you. The new defaults ship as the following configuration values.

settings of hagug-fawip:
BRIWYN_LOG_LEVEL=warn
BRIWYN_METRICS_HOST=metrics.briwyn.qorvelsys.internal
BRIWYN_POOL_SIZE=8

- [ ] Step 7: Archive cold storage buckets (Glacierline tier). Confirm both ceremony witnesses are present, verify bucket manifests match the Oxbow ledger, then seal the archive key shares. Plugin authors may observe but not handle shares. Once sealed, the archive index itself is encrypted and can only be reopened with the passphrase below.

vault phrase of badup-hahig = tamael-aldael-kelmir-istael-fenok-istwyn-tamius-jorath-oliion

// Client setup for the Quotaline tenant-metering service.
// Each tenant gets a per-minute quota enforced server-side;
// do NOT retry on 429, backoff is handled by the wrapper.
// Quota tiers are configured in the Quotaline console, not here.
// The client authenticates with a static service key.
// The key used for this deployment is the following.

API key for yahig-tadup: kto7_ubizbYm

Orders in the Cartloft database are never hard-deleted. Each row in the orders table carries a deleted_at timestamp; application queries filter on it via a shared view. Purge jobs remove soft-deleted rows after 180 days per retention policy. Audit access to soft-deleted rows requires the data-steward role. Questions about retention exceptions go to the records governance team.

escalation mailbox, bafog-fafog: ulador@paliqlabs.internal